Prince Harry eyes Invictus Games countdown event as path back to royal family
Prince Harry believes Invictus Games event could help mend relations with King Charles
Prince Harry is reportedly hopeful that the upcoming countdown event for the Invictus Games 2027 could help rebuild his relationship with the royal family.
According to Heat Magazine, the Duke of Sussex is viewing his recent trip to Australia with Meghan Markle as “dress rehearsal” for their royal return.
Harry will return to UK this summer for the one-year countdown event ahead of the Games in Birmingham and Meghan is expected to join.
Speaking with the publication, an insider said that the couple wanted to show with their Australia trip what they could offer if allowed to support royal duties in a limited capacity.
“Harry was mindful going into this trip that it was like a dress rehearsal for the royals to see what they’re missing out on – and what they’d stand to gain by allowing him and Meghan back into the fold part-time,” they said.
The insider added, “The Invictus Games will be a perfect springboard for Harry and Meghan to come back, and there’s no reason why the royals wouldn’t give their backing to a charity event like this.”
They further shared, “The distraction of a cause like Invictus will be a welcome one for King Charles and the monarchy, and it’s no secret Charles has been pushing hard behind the scenes for people to give Harry and Meghan another chance.”
“Harry has already formally approached his father in the hope that he’ll open the Invictus Games when the time comes. If it happens, it will be a very public way for the Sussexes to be welcomed back into the fold.”
